  • Abstract
    A neuron model-free control method with immune scheme tuning gain for hydroelectric generating units is presented in this paper. Under the operating conditions of various guide vane opening, the characteristics of a hydroelectric generating unit show much difference in parameters. The influences of the time-varying parameters and the disturbances on the control system can be reduced by using the neuron model-free control method with immune scheme turning gain. With an example, the simulation results show that the neuron model-free controller has good control performance, fast transient response and strong robustness.
